ARTIST STATEMENT
Arlo Jake Lagmay, born in 1991, is a Basel-based Filipino visual artist. His work investigates the nature of perception and idea and how their polarization questions the realm of reality.
He employs the juxtaposition of flat surfaces and imaginary figures with real architectural elements, fusing Dadaism and Surrealism transporting viewers into a floating and dreamlike scene and requiring them to decide where from there the reason goes. This vantage point is the wormhole where the limits of time and distance are suspended or shattered, showing the forms of distorted bodies, surreality of nature, and provocative flesh all witnessed by the viewers.
